Real Detroit, Feb. 11, 1999

Local Spins
60 Second Crush
Love For a Minute
Aural Pleasure

Having not seen the band live, I cannot compare the sound on this disc to what you might hear onstage. If the energy level coming off these spins is any sign, however, it would be one helluva show.

Love For A Minute is reminiscent of the early 80's proto-punk sound (Black Flag, Bad Brains, etc.), with
a raw industrial sound mixed with subtle harmonies.  The opening "Jam" does just that, with lead singer Tom Harman's growling voice crawling over the fast-paced
aural minefield. Included is an acid-dropping take on "Ruby Don't Take Your Love to Town," and the
hammerhead pounding chords of "Destruction." Other strong numbers include the funked up "Anger" and the slightly bittersweet "Why Ask Why."
